Steps
-
Remove stems from shiitake mushrooms. Wash and dry.
-
Put the shiitake mushroom stems, meat cut into small pieces, and an egg into a manual meat grinder. Stir into minced meat, take it out and stir clockwise with your hands to form a paste.
-
After drying the mushrooms, apply a layer of starch one by one. (This is to prevent the meat filling from falling off during stewing)
-
Time is tight, so I can't take pictures of how to stir-fry the pot. I'll just describe it orally. Those of us who often cook will understand. Heat oil in a pan, add minced ginger, chopped green onion, minced garlic and sauté until fragrant, 1 tablespoon of soybean paste, continue to stir-fry, and pour in appropriate amount of water.
-
Use your hands to put the seasoned meat filling into the mushrooms one by one and flatten them. Arrange them one by one in the pot and set over low heat.
-
When the aroma of the mushrooms comes out, you can put it on a plate and take it out of the pot. Finally, thicken the remaining soup in the pot with water starch and pour it on top of each mushroom on the plate. Sprinkle with chopped green onion for garnish.
